Output 93ade270a6f3063b4039b5315e95fb9efccabd0bc4e6ce247e838fd51843ba10:0

value
51385
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c99faabed984228f01b50d679c7beab0b39356436cc82eb8c1720f8e8b24c9e
address
bc1pejvl42ldnppz3uqm2rt8n3a74v9njdtyxmxg96uvzus0369jfj0qejrze8
transaction
93ade270a6f3063b4039b5315e95fb9efccabd0bc4e6ce247e838fd51843ba10
spent
true